Summary: 

  • Lead Product Development (PD) and recurring Production Run (PR) programs for key customers.

  • Review contracts and purchase orders in collaboration with senior management, engineering, and production teams.

  • Gather customer product and technical requirements and communicate capabilities and limitations.

  • Present product development prototype results and support transitions into recurring production using MS PowerPoint.

  • Develop an understanding of OHP manufacturing processes to create build plans and conduct risk assessments.

  • Coordinate with engineering and manufacturing teams to establish lead times and ensure timely contract deliverables.

  • Maintain project schedules and Gantt charts, communicating updates and timeline adjustments with customers as needed.

  • Facilitate customer action items, meeting minutes, and cross-functional communication.

  • Support ERP system improvements and integration into operational processes.

  • Assist manufacturing teams in optimizing materials, processes, and supply chains.

  • Support procurement activities, including bill of materials and manufacturing processes.

  • Lead customer communications for troubleshooting, root cause analysis, and technical support.

  • Ensure quality assurance and compliance with DV&T and AS9100 requirements, including creation of required documentation.

  • Represent at customer meetings, web conferences, technical workshops, and tradeshows.

  • Track project spending, support invoicing, and address scope changes when applicable.

  • Contribute to continuous process and facility improvements to support operational growth and innovation.

Requirements:

  • Bachelor of Science degree in Business, Engineering, or a related technical field required.

  • Minimum of 5 years of experience in program or project management.

  • Ability to read and interpret mechanical drawings and schematics.

  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ite, including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Outlook.

  • Strong written and verbal communication skills.

  • Understanding of PDM and ERP systems.

  • Ability to pass a background check.

  • Must be a U.S. Person (as defined by ITAR).

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Experience in aerospace or thermal-mechanical product development industries.

  • Experience supporting air or spaceborne platform product development.

  • Knowledge of manufacturing operations including CNC machining, brazing, bonding, TIG welding, and laser welding.
